Tantalum Capacitors

Tantalum capacitors are a type of passive electronic component that store and release electrical energy in an electronic circuit. They are named after the element tantalum, which is used in their construction due to its high capacitance density.

Definition:
Tantalum capacitors consist of a tantalum powder anode, a dielectric layer made from tantalum pentoxide (Ta2O5), and a conductive cathode. The dielectric layer is formed by anodizing the tantalum anode, creating a thin, insulating film. The cathode is typically made from a conductive material such as manganese dioxide or a solid electrolyte.

Function:
The primary function of a tantalum capacitor is to provide capacitance, which allows it to store an electrical charge. This is achieved by creating an electric field between the anode and cathode when a voltage is applied. Tantalum capacitors are known for their high capacitance values in a small physical size, making them ideal for applications where space is limited.

Selection Criteria:
When choosing a tantalum capacitor, several factors should be considered:

1. Capacitance Value: The amount of charge the capacitor can store at a given voltage.
2. Voltage Rating: The maximum voltage the capacitor can withstand without breaking down.
3. Size and Form Factor: The physical dimensions and shape of the capacitor, which must fit within the available space.
4. Temperature Range: The operating temperature range of the capacitor, which should match the environment in which it will be used.
5. Reliability and Lifespan: The expected lifespan and reliability of the capacitor, which can be influenced by factors such as the quality of the dielectric and the manufacturing process.
6. Cost: Tantalum capacitors can be more expensive than other types of capacitors, so cost may be a consideration.

In summary, tantalum capacitors offer high capacitance in a small package, making them suitable for a wide range of applications where space is limited and high performance is required. When selecting a tantalum capacitor, it is important to consider the capacitance, voltage rating, size, temperature range, reliability, and cost to ensure the best fit for the specific application.
